RN104 start failed after update 6.5.0
Hi I updated the RN104 Nas from 6.4.2 to 6.5.0. I started the update from readycloud website after upgraded my account The nas downloaded and installed the new firmware, but can't start. Rea...
- Jun 01, 2016
Hi
Problem solved.
I mounted some directory from externa usb device in fstab
But when booting the device first try to mount disks from NOT mounted device ... (directory not found)
So can fix readynasd to skip these user error and log out :)
Remove it -> /media/USB_HDD_5/MyData /Data/MyData rw bind

- mdgm-ntgrJun 01, 2016NETGEAR Employee Retired
Well the firmware upgrade guide and tips indicates that updating the firmware when the volume is very full is not recommended.
You really should keep your volume under 80% full.
You are using a non-redundant volume configuration and one of your disks has a non-zero current pending sector count.
You probably should backup your data, do a factory default (wipes all data, settings, everything) with good disks installed and restore your data from backup.
